MediaSoft Analysts Weekend — онлайн-митап для аналитиков. Поговорим об аналитике и разберемся в USE CASE, документации, интеграциях с применением протоколов и брокерах сообщений. 00:00:00 Начало трансляции 00:21:40 Идеальный USE CASE: как описать сценарий, чтобы его не вернули на доработку — USE CASE: что это такое и зачем он нужен — Графическое отображение: почему текстового описания недостаточно и вам надо рисовать диаграмму — Текстовое описание: разбираемся с полями, триггерами, предусловиями, сценариями, расширениями и т.д. — Основные ошибки при написании USE CASE, которые допускают аналитики 00:47:09 Интеграции с применением REST, SOAP, gRPC, GraphQL: обзор протоколов, как выглядят и где используются — Архитектура REST: ресурсы, глаголы и статусы — Язык GraphQL: схемы данных и запросы — Протокол gRPC: Protobuf и быстрый обмен данными — Протокол SOAP: XML и общение со складами 01:11:35 Брокеры сообщений RabbitMQ, Kafka и Redis в работе системного аналитика: как и когда стоит использовать — Что такое брокеры сообщений — Как и когда их стоит использовать — Какие альтернативы в SQL-решениях и нюансы фасетного поиска — Примеры кейсов, в каких случаях предпочтительно использовать каждый из инструментов 01:40:15 Документация: описываем методы API в зависимости от способа интеграции в приложении — Что такое API и зачем его документировать — Идеальный шаблон описания API — Что обязательно нужно указать в документации, а чем можно пренебречь. Как на описание повлияет способ интеграции в системе — Где искать примеры хорошей документации
Hide player controls
Hide resume playing